What challenges does Nobu face at the women's normal school dormitory in Episode 5?

In Episode 5 of Anpan Season 1, Nobu Asada enters the dormitory of a women's normal school in 1936 and faces overwhelming militaristic discipline imposed by her teacher Yukiko Kuroi, which creates a difficult environment for her and her friend Usako.

How does Takashi Yanai's career path evolve in Episode 5?

Takashi Yanai, initially retaking entrance exams to become a doctor, reveals in Episode 5 that he cannot envision himself as a doctor and decides instead to pursue art school, reflecting a significant shift in his aspirations.

What is the significance of the Asada household's situation during Nobu's absence in Episode 5?

While Nobu is away at school in Episode 5, the Asada household experiences notable events, including the second daughter Ranko receiving important news, indicating ongoing family dynamics and challenges during Nobu's absence.

Who are the key characters interacting with Nobu and Takashi in Episode 5, and what roles do they play?

In Episode 5, Nobu interacts with her friend Usako and the strict teacher Yukiko Kuroi at school, while Takashi confides in his friend Chihiro about his career doubts. Additionally, family members such as Ranko Asada and others in the Asada household influence the unfolding story.
